Kanji Detail for 母 - "mother, nurturing, origin"

  • Meaning

    母 means "mother, nurturing, origin."

    1. Mother - Female parent; mom.

    2. Grandmother - An elderly female relative.

    3. Wet nurse - A nursing woman.

    4. Origin - The source that produces things; the foundation.

    XSZD Xuéshēng Zìdiǎn (學生字典) - Student's Dictionary

    Father and mother. Those who gave birth to me. See "父" for details. | Anything from which things originate is called 母. As in denominator and numerator (分母分子), capital and interest (母財子財), and the like. | Senior female relatives are all called 母. As in paternal aunt (姑母), wife of maternal uncle (舅母). | Female birds and beasts are all called 母. Mencius says: "Five hens and two sows" (五母雞。二母彘).
